This visual album features artists Nicole Scherzinger, Jordin Sparks, Perez Hilton, Joseph Gordon-Levitt, Amber Riley, Raven Symoné and Tamar Braxton among others, telling the emotional story of Broadway star Todrick Hall's upbringing and rise to fame as a gay black man in the entertainment business, while holding the theme of 'The Wizard of Oz'.
